British pop-deity Alexandra Burke returns with new Red One produced summer anthem.

After ruling the airwaves for weeks with her last Top Five hit ‘All Night Long,’ Alexandra Burke delivers her next, all new smash ‘Start Without You’ in August. Fusing traditional reggae influences with dancehall beats and power-pop melodies, the track is set to cause a long-lasting heat wave when it hits radio in July; and with remixes courtesy of Stonebridge Alexandra will also be blazing club floors across the country once again.

Written and produced by Lady Gaga mastermind Red One, ‘Start Without You’ was recorded in the spring and will be available for the very first time this summer. The track features new Jamaican-American Reggae and Hip Hop artist Laza on rhyming duty, a member of the legendary Morgan family (dubbed ‘The Royal Family of Reggae’)

The last 18 months have been a triumph for music’s most exciting pop juggernaut, Alexandra Burke. Four huge hit singles (including two number ones) a number one double-platinum album, innumerable radio spins and a performance for The Queen have cemented her place as the UK’s prime female recording artist.

In 2009, Alexandra released her A-list produced debut album ‘Overcome,’ which went straight to Number One in the UK and has already born four huge chart hits (‘Hallelujah,’ ‘Bad Boys,’ ‘Broken Heels’ and ‘All Night Long.’) Created with the help of perhaps the industries most in-demand production houses (Roc Nation and Jay-Z, The Phantom Boyz, Red One, Ne-Yo and Stargate) the album has already sold in excess of 600,000 copies in the UK alone. With mainland Europe also falling in love with Alexandra this diva’s star is supernova.
